How to Build Muscle Mass Fast Naturally
To build muscle fast, you need to focus on three things: Strength training Good nutrition Recovery and sleep When you lift weights or do resistance training, tiny tears appear in your muscle fibres. Your body repairs these tears with protein and nutrients, causing your muscles to grow bigger and stronger. This is called muscle hypertrophy.

The 3 Most Important Rules for Muscle Growth
1. Train Your Muscles Regularly
Your muscles need a reason to grow Exercises that promote muscle growth include push-ups, squats, pull-ups, bench press and deadlifts.
2. Eat More Calories Than You Burn
If you’re skinny and not gaining muscle, you are likely not eating enough. Your body needs more calories to build new muscle.
3. Sleep Properly
Your muscles don’t grow while you’re working out. They grow while you sleep. Sleep for 7-9 hours is very important for recovery.

How Much Protein for Muscle Building?
Since muscles are made of protein, protein is one of the most important nutrients for muscle gain.
Recommended Protein Intake
For muscle building, most people need:
1.6−2.2 grams of protein per kilogram of body weight per day
For example:
- If your weight is 60 kg, you should aim for around 96–132 grams of protein daily.

Supplements
Whey protein is handy if you can’t get your daily protein needs from food.
But keep in mind: supplements are just to help support your diet. Your first priority should always be real food.
